SAC Women’s Basketball  Drops OEC Matchup to Riverside, 73-66

SANTA ANA, Calif. - Despite making 14 three-pointers in Wednesday's Orange Empire Conference matchup against Riverside (11-11, 5-4), the Santa Ana Women's Basketball team was defeated by a score of 73-66. 

The Dons were just one three away from the single season school record (15 in 2017-2018 vs. Orange Coast) and shot 43.8 percent from downtown against the Tigers. 

Freshman guard Heather Matthews made six of those, finishing with 18 points with seven rebounds. Fellow freshman Sophia Escalante scored a team high 22 points and accounted for four threes herself. 

Although the Dons made some improvements offensively, they could not keep the Tigers off the boards as they lost the rebound battle 48-34, which was ultimately the difference in the game.
